Ids camera matlab tutorial pdf

Fire detection based on matlab digital image processing. The adaptors main purpose is to pass information between matlab and an image acquisition device via its driver. If the url is not working in matlab, verify the url that the camera is using by looking at it in a browser. It simplifies the example motionbased multiple object tracking computer vision toolbox and uses the multiobjecttracker available in automated driving toolbox. Using the kinect for windows v1 from image acquisition. Introduction to matlab exercises and solution notes. Ids imaging development systems gmbh is a leading manufacturer of digital industrial cameras. Use the exact name that is displayed by the webcamlist function, such as logitech webcam 250, or use a shortened version of the name, such as the camera brand. I mostly record myself solving math and statistics problems. Face detection using matlab full project with source code. Pdf understanding digital image processing using matlab.

A graphic user interface gui allows users to perform tasks interactively through controls like switches and sliders. The image processing toolbox is a collection of functions. Get rgb matrix of an usbcamera ueye stack overflow. Controlling ueye eye camera in matlab with shared library by. Digital image processing using matlab university of maryland. Matlab basics tutorial vektor fungsi plot polinomials matriks printing mencetak menggunakan mfiles di matlab diferensial integral help di matlab matlab adalah interactive program untuk numerical computation dan data visualization. You can also set devicespecific properties for a specific webcam, if supported by your device.

You can easily create a gui and run it in matlab or as a standalone application. With previous versions of the image acquisition toolbox, the files for all of the adaptors were included in your installation. Nov 08, 2016 i am using an ids ueye camera and want to use it on matlab. This realtime face detection program is developed using matlab version r2012a. In order to use the image acquisition toolbox, you must install the adaptor that your camera uses. If the camera is integrated into the computer or laptop, skip to step 4.

Aim is to provide basic knowledge on matlabsimulink. We provide pdf matlab which contain sample source code for various networking projects. However, this particular camera is supported by the image acquisition toolbox, with a relevant tutorial here. See image acquisition support packages for hardware adaptors for information about installing the adaptors go through the configuration steps of the gige vision quick start configuration guide, which can be opened from. If multiple nodes try to transmit a mess age onto the can bus at the same time, the node with the highest priority low est arbitration id automatically gets bus. I have the same question, wondering if anyone found a solution. Play the waveform, write it to a wav le, and use the specgram. This example shows how to acquire multiple image frames from an ip camera, and log the images to an avi file using matlab videowriter. See image acquisition support packages for hardware adaptors for information about installing the adaptors.

Openmandriva lx, based on mandriva and mandrake code, is an exciting free desktop operating system that aims to cater to and interest first time and advanced users alike. In the final section of this chap ter, we use an integrated suit e of matlab software tools to. The ueye cockpit provides access to all major camera settings and features. The project is not ready for use, then incomplete pieces of code may be found. On this tutorial, we will be focusing on raspberry pi so, raspbian as os and python, but i also tested the code on my mac and it also works fine. Activex uses the com interface, which is now no longer supported by ids ueye cameras. In this tutorial we learn all the theory and principles of a face recognition system and develop a very simple face recognition system based on mean and standard deviation features. Hardware package for ids ueye camera not point matlab. Using support from image acquisition toolbox, you can create imaging solutions with a variety of cameras and frame grabbers.

Stereo camera calibrator app stereo camera calibrator overview. Activex, camera ueye matlab answers matlab central. They contribute to the provision of useful functions of the website. Scenario generation from recorded vehicle data matlab. Net sdk manual for further information and functions. High frequency ids camera capture linux and windows only. Ids software suite ids imaging development systems gmbh.

Set objectspecific properties for the webcam object to use with any webcam. The kernel intrusion detection systemkids, is a network ids, where the main part, packets grabstring match, is running at kernelspace, with a hook of netfilter framework. However sift features invariance to image rotation and scaling, changes in lighting, 3d camera view point and partial occlusion, make them suitable for face recognition. Click on the apps tab and then select the image acquisition app. Id like to record video from an ids ueye camera using the. It creates the object and connects it to the ip camera with the specified url. Again, in this tutorial arduino due is used as an example but the same steps can be used for other boards like uno, mega 2560 etc. Cookies of this category are required for the basic functions of the ids website. Install the camera on top of the computer or laptop lid. Net interface in freerun mode to get the max framerate. I want to get the images from ids cameras by using the matlab 2015a with the image acquisition toolbox directly without using ids.

An adaptor is the interface between matlab and the image acquisition devices connected to the system. This tutorial provides an overview of how to configure the various settings available ids ueye cameras within motionview video analysis. A video input object represents the connection between matlab and a video acquisition device at a high level. Acquire ip camera images in a loop and create an avi file. Installing the support packages for image acquisition toolbox. Matlab det matematisknaturvitenskapelige fakultet, uio.

Matlab mengintegrasikan komputasi, visualisasi, dan pemrograman dalam suatu model yang sangat. Image acquisition toolbox with ids camera matlab answers. Getting started intel realsense with the intel realsense. Because the kinect for windows camera has two separate sensors, the color sensor and the depth sensor, the toolbox lists two deviceids. It also supports two modes of tracking people based on whether they are standing or seated. Image acquisition toolbox can acquire images from the usb3 camera via the genicam gentl support.

The tutorial is a joint project of the institutes imes, imr, ifw and ids. Configuring and connecting the flir gige vision camera to matlab. I am using an ids ueye camera and want to use it on matlab. So, its perfect for realtime face recognition using a camera. Scan clear images into pdf docs with camera scanner and sharesave as pdf or doc. Super free scanner app that scans everything, documents to pdf. In standing mode, the full 20 joint locations are tracked and returned. The image file names must start with a common basename, followed by a number all numbers must be in sequence with step one, and the file extension ras, bmp, pgm, ppm, tif. How can i insert live video into a matlab gui using image.

Thorlabs also offers a wide variety of camera lenses, objectives, and mounts for use with our ccd and cmos cameras. Provide an interactive environment for iterative exploration, design and problem solving. As the name suggests, im a math and other things channel. This example shows how to use the snapshot function to acquire one image frame from an ip camera and display it. Digital image processing using matlab bit planes greyscale images can be transformed into a sequence of binary images by breaking them up into their bitplanes. Our cmos cameras offer a fullframe resolution of 1280 x 1024 pixels. Matlab tutorial dasar pengolahan citra menggunakan matlab. The app can either estimate or import the parameters of individual cameras. Use matlab to write an audio waveform 8 khz sampling frequency that contains a sequence of nine tones with frequencies 659, 622, 659, 622, 659, 494, 587, 523, and 440 hz. Matlab help matlab help is an extremely powerful assistance to learning matlab help not only contains the theoretical background, but also shows demos for implementation matlab help can be opened by using the help pulldown menu. Hi adam and yarden i have the same question, wondering if anyone found a solution. Camera matrix 16385 computer vision kris kitani carnegie mellon university.

I checked in the forum and it seems that the links with the package are expired. We set up the web cam, then upload the file and made magic. Understanding of digital image processing using matlab is a book for a course of image processing using matlab along with techniques for developing gui and to covers few advanced topics. Matlab tool contains many algorithms and toolboxes freely available. Camera calibration tutorial well test it out in the lab matlab. For more details on skeletal data, see the matlab documentation on kinect for windows adaptor.

Our quantalux, kiralux, and scientific ccd array cameras can be used in microscopy, materials inspection, and other demanding quantitative imaging applications. Starting with version r2014a, each adaptor is available separately through matlab addons. I connected an ueye camera to the computer and want to analyse it frame by frame in realtime. Acquire any number of images no maximum number, and save them in a common folder in either format. Learn more about loadlibrary, shared library, camera, ueye, eye, dll, pointers, sample. Installing the support packages for image acquisition. Install the image acquisition toolbox support package for gige vision hardware. However, this particular camera is supported by the image acquisition toolbox, with a relevant tutorial here the long answer is that if you supplement your matlab code with some mexc, you could make it work, although i dont have any specifics.

The properties supported by the video input object are the same for every type of device. Matlab for image processing a guide to basic matlab functions for image processing with matlab exercises yao wang and fanyi duanmu tandon school of engineering, new york university jan. An additional class is offered, where students may do free exercises assisted by tutors. Does anybody have experience with that kind of programming. Industrial cameras ids imaging development systems gmbh. Getting started doing image acquisition programmatically. Our selection of cmount camera lenses includes standard prime fixed lenses, zoom lenses, and telecentric machine vision lenses that are ideal for imaging and machine vision applications. Opencv was designed for computational efficiency and with a strong focus on realtime applications. Hardware support from image acquisition toolbox hardware. This document is not a comprehensive introduction or a reference manual. A memo on how to use the levenbergmarquardt algorithm. Design a simple face recognition system in matlab from.

Dasar image processing menggunakan matlab 2 tentang matlab matlab adalah sebuah bahasa dengan highperformance kinerja tinggi untuk komputasi masalah teknik. The matlab prompt supports common linux and windows shell commands pwd current directory path cd newdirectory change directory lsdir lists. Learn more about image acquisition, matlab, video, image acquisition toolbox image acquisition toolbox. If you use the webcam function with the name of the camera as a character vector as the input argument, it creates the object and connects to the camera with that name. Click on the apps tab and then select the image acquisition. It is used for freshmen classes at northwestern university. Scanner app free camera scanner is a simple document scanner to pdf. Net interface, which is fairly similar to the end user. This tutorial uses a 8x6 checkerboard with 108mm squares.

Nov 08, 2016 hardware package for ids ueye camera not point. Typically, each camera or image device in the image acquisition toolbox has one deviceid. Starting with version r2014a, each adaptor is available separately through support packages. This way of creating the object requires no user authentication, so the username and password properties are blank in the object display. For finite projective cameras, the correspondence between points in the world and points in the image. Video showing, tracking red color objects using matlab, original code written by. The external transformation parameters 3d rotation and translation for each of the given views of the reference pattern.

You can use the stereo camera calibrator app to calibrate a stereo camera, which you can then use to recover depth from images. Matlab integrates computation, visualization, and programming in an easytouse en vironment, and allows easy matrix manipulation, plotting of functions and data, implementation of algorithms, creation of user interfaces, and interfacing with programs in other languages. Downloads overview of suitable drivers and manuals for ids products knowledge base deepen your knowledge with techtips, case studies, programming examples etc. Active exercises take place in the facultys cip pool at 5 dates. I wanted to do the subsampling in both horizontal and vertical orientation, but from the ueye. Spectral analysis with matlab this webinar steps you through performing data analysis, spectral analysis, and timefrequency analysis using signal processing toolbox functions.

The text file consists of five columns that store the actor ids, xpositions, ypositions, zpositions and timestamp values, respectively. Using a flir gige camera in matlab configuring and connecting the flir gige vision camera to matlab. We consider the grey value of each pixel of an 8bit image as an 8bit binary word. Computer vision with matlab massachusetts institute of. They can be used in a wide range of applications from microscopy to monitoring. If your camera or frame grabber is supported by both the industry standard and manufacturer support, it is recommended that you use the manufacturer support. Check with your manufacturer to see if they provide a gentl producer for the usb3 camera. The initial program output of this project is shown in fig. Installing the support packages for image acquisition toolbox adaptors.

Standard and extended can frames arbitration id the arbitration id determines the priority of the messages on the bus. Camera calibration app this calibration algorithm makes use of multiple images of a asymmetric chessboard. Image acquisition toolbox supports camera link cameras via supported frame grabbers. Multi cameras are connected with a switch netgear gs110tp which is connected to the computer by ethernet. These compact, lightweight cmos cameras are available with either a monochrome m models, color c models, or nir n model sensor. The widely recognised scale invariant feature transform sift proposed by lowe is used. Use imaqhwinfo on the adaptor to display the two device ids. It has the breadth and depth of an advanced system but is designed to be simple and straightforward in u. Starting with version r2014a, each adaptor is available separately in support packages via matlab addons. As mentioned in the previous chapter, the power that matlab brings to digital image processing is an extensive set of functions for processing multidimensional arrays of which images twodimensional numerical arrays are a special case. Then add to this waveform a copy of itself in which every other sample has been multiplied by 1. See cameralink for more information usb3 vision support. Can anyone provide an example of 1 configuring the camera in freerun mode and 2 saving the resulting video as either. Matlab for image processing a guide to basic matlab.

Signal analysis made easy this webinar showcases how easy it is to perform signal analysis in matlab. Robert style view profile i want to get the images from ids cameras by using the matlab 2015a with the image acquisition toolbox directly without using ids. Use dot notation to set objectspecific or devicespecific properties. Use the helpergetnonegodata function to import the nonego actor data from the text file into a structure in the matlab workspace.

159 841 329 1471 1005 552 64 1004 1130 371 1423 1126 1004 291 1004 1236 1096 902 644 1155 1115 754 1048 943 840 413 443 321 118 1221 1350 1337 119